Avalara helps businesses of all sizes achieve compliance with sales tax, excise tax, and other transactional tax requirements by delivering comprehensive, automated, cloud-based solutions that are fast, accurate and easy to use.  Avalara’s end-to-end suite of solutions is designed to effectively manage complicated and burdensome tax compliance obligations imposed by state, local, and other taxing authorities in the United States and internationally.

Avalara is looking for fiercely competitive Account Development Representatives to identify net new prospects through outbound prospecting. The primary role is to prospect net new targets over the phone and set up discovery calls and meetings for Launch Managers on the Partner Development Team to help achieve revenue targets

Account Development Representatives (ADRs) are tasked with identifying high value opportunities and working closely with the marketing partners to research lists of companies to target, develop email and telephone campaigns and follow through with general ongoing contact with prospects to help nurture them through the sales funnel to generate new business opportunities. This position has advancement potential within the sales/marketing or business development organization.

About Avalara

Avalara helps businesses of all sizes achieve compliance with transaction taxes, including sales and use, VAT, excise, communications, and other tax types. The company delivers comprehensive, automated, cloud-based solutions designed to be fast, accurate, and easy to use. The Avalara Compliance Cloud® platform helps customers manage complicated and burdensome tax compliance obligations imposed by state, local, and other taxing authorities throughout the world.

Avalara offers more than 600 pre-built connectors into leading accounting, ERP, ecommerce and other business applications, making the integration of tax and compliance solutions easy for customers. Each year, the company processes billions of indirect tax transactions for customers and users, files more than a million tax returns, and manages millions of tax exemption certificates and other compliance documents.

Headquartered in Seattle, Avalara has offices across the U.S. and overseas in the U.K., Belgium, Brazil, and India. More information at www.avalara.com
